Output 18871cb59c648ffc989c711be26baca6da0cff7dca32a8764fd37b942d53fd69:0

value
11524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 683c2239ae916a95b6169f970e1255411793c358 OP_EQUAL
address
3BCAEf29mbRAZP2UR55h8sWQkKWLDfBc1D
transaction
18871cb59c648ffc989c711be26baca6da0cff7dca32a8764fd37b942d53fd69
spent
true